  7. Let's please put into perspective the success of a short put strategy in a ragin bull market...

    That often makes put selling look like a home run cannot lose approach until the market starts dropping and you are selling falling knives.

    Also, the market was up so much you would have made way more money with the same type of leverage simply going long the market as short puts are profit capped.
